<center><bold><FontFamily><param>Times New Roman</param><bigger><bigger><bigger><bigger><bigger><bigger><bigger><bigger><bigger>CALL FOR PAPERS</bold><bigger><bigger><bigger><bigger><bigger><bigger><bigger><bigger><bigger></center>

<center><bold><smaller><smaller><smaller><smaller><smaller><smaller><smaller><smaller><smaller><smaller><smaller>‘Germany and the Celtic 
Countries in History’</center>

<center><smaller><smaller><smaller><smaller>A conference to be held at the</center>

<center> University of Ulster,</center>

<center>Magee College, Derry/Londonderry,</center>

<center>13-15 September 2001.</bold><smaller><smaller><smaller></center>


<flushboth><bigger>The conference aims to investigate historical relations 
between Germany and all of the Celtic countries throughout 
the ages. Papers may cover any aspect of this relationship, 
whether in the mediaeval or modern era. Celtic missionary 
activity in southern Germany; Celtic exiles in German-
speaking Europe; Germany and Brittany in WW2; German 
soldiers and Palatine refugees in Ireland; Historical German 
writing on the Celtic countries; Historical writing from the 
Celtic countries on Germany; The German study of the 
Celts in history. The above are just some of the themes that 
conference papers might address. Abstracts of not more 
than 200 words should be submitted by 28 February 2001 
to the address below. The advisory panel will select papers 
and announce the programme in March 2001.</flushboth>
